Output e17ffdcdf0c85e739afa94bbc99439e12ec5cc6e6e0ad67aee93d0c80efd6da9:23

value
835810083
script pubkey
OP_0 OP_PUSHBYTES_20 a31822ea5748331b343489f4785e6b2fb6891bbf
address
bc1q5vvz96jhfqe3kdp53868shnt97mgjxalhlgk40
transaction
e17ffdcdf0c85e739afa94bbc99439e12ec5cc6e6e0ad67aee93d0c80efd6da9
confirmations
168421
spent
true